The Role of Love in Personal Growth

Love isn’t just a fleeting emotion—it’s a way of being. It starts with self-love, the foundation of how we interact with the world. When we nurture a loving relationship with ourselves, we make choices that honor our well-being, set healthy boundaries, and allow us to show up authentically.

Loving yourself means accepting your flaws, forgiving past mistakes, and recognizing your worth. It also means extending love outward—to others, to life itself, and even to challenges that shape you. When love is your guide, decisions become clearer, and life feels more expansive rather than restrictive.

The Power of Joy: Finding Happiness in the Present Moment

Joy isn’t something we need to chase—it’s something we can cultivate right now. Often, we attach happiness to future achievements: “I’ll be happy when I get that promotion,” or “I’ll feel fulfilled when I find the perfect relationship.” But joy isn’t found in a distant future; it’s created in the small, present moments.

Joy is in laughter, deep conversations, morning sunrises, and even the quiet peace of solitude. It’s in appreciating what we already have rather than constantly seeking more. When we prioritize joy, we shift from a mindset of scarcity to one of abundance, and suddenly, life feels lighter.

Why Trust Matters: Embracing the Unknown with Confidence

Trust is the anchor that holds everything together. It’s the belief that, no matter what happens, you will find your way. It’s trusting yourself to make the right choices, trusting life to unfold as it should, and trusting that even setbacks have purpose.

Fear often convinces us that we must control every outcome to be safe. But in reality, control is an illusion. The most freeing thing we can do is surrender—not in a passive way, but in an empowered way, knowing that we have everything we need to navigate whatever comes our way.

Trust allows us to take risks, follow our intuition, and step into the unknown without paralyzing fear. It reminds us that even when things don’t go as planned, we are still on the right path.

How to Cultivate Love, Joy, and Trust in Daily Life

  1. Practice Self-Compassion – Speak to yourself with kindness and remind yourself that you are worthy of love and good things.
  2. Find Small Moments of Joy – Start noticing the little things that bring happiness, and intentionally seek them out.
  3. Let Go of Control – When you feel overwhelmed, pause and remind yourself that you don’t have to figure everything out at once.
  4. Trust Your Intuition – Instead of second-guessing every decision, learn to listen to that inner knowing.
  5. Surround Yourself with Positive Energy – Choose people, activities, and thoughts that uplift you rather than drain you.
